紧急!学会这3招,轻松应对MySQL数据丢失危机,案例详解,关键时刻救命
在数字时代,数据就像是企业的生命线。MySQL作为最流行的开源关系数据库之一,其数据的安全性成为许多企业和开发者关注的焦点。然而,数据丢失的风险始终存在。在这个紧急时刻,掌握以下三招,能够帮助您轻松应对MySQL数据丢失的危机。
1. 定期备份数据
核心要点:定期备份是防止数据丢失最直接有效的方法。
操作步骤:
- 使用MySQL自带的备份工具:如
mysqldump,这是一个强大的命令行工具,可以备份数据库中的所有数据。
mysqldump -u [username] -p [database_name] > backup.sql
- 定时任务:可以使用操作系统的定时任务功能(如Linux的cron),定期执行备份操作。
0 2 * * * /usr/bin/mysqldump -u [username] -p[password] [database_name] > /path/to/backup.sql
- 存储备份:将备份文件存储在安全的位置,如网络存储或外部硬盘。
案例详解:
假设某公司数据库中的销售数据丢失,由于定期备份,他们只需从最近的备份中恢复数据,避免了严重的经济损失。
2. 使用RAID技术
核心要点:RAID(Redundant Array of Independent Disks)技术可以提高数据的安全性。
RAID级别:
- RAID 1:镜像,提供数据冗余。
- RAID 5:分布式奇偶校验,提供数据冗余和性能提升。
实施步骤:
选择RAID卡:根据需要选择支持相应RAID级别的RAID卡。
配置RAID:在RAID卡的控制界面配置RAID级别。
安装操作系统和MySQL:在RAID配置完成后,安装操作系统和MySQL。
案例详解:
某企业使用RAID 5配置存储MySQL数据,尽管有一块硬盘故障,但数据仍然安全,无需恢复。
3. 数据恢复软件
核心要点:在数据丢失时,使用专业的数据恢复软件可以最大程度地恢复数据。
常用软件:
- EaseUS Data Recovery Wizard:支持多种文件系统和数据恢复场景。
- MiniTool Power Data Recovery:操作简单,恢复速度快。
恢复步骤:
选择恢复模式:根据丢失的数据类型选择恢复模式。
扫描磁盘:软件会扫描磁盘,查找丢失的数据。
预览和恢复:预览恢复的数据,选择需要恢复的文件。
案例详解:
某用户误删了MySQL数据库中的重要文件,使用数据恢复软件成功恢复了文件,避免了数据丢失带来的损失。
总结
数据丢失对于企业和个人来说都是一场灾难。通过以上三招,您可以有效地预防数据丢失,并在关键时刻救命。记住,预防永远比治疗更重要。
